Understanding Bread Flour and All-Purpose Flour

Bread flour and all-purpose flour are both made from wheat, but they differ in their protein content. Protein content is a critical factor in determining the strength and structure of the final product. Bread flour typically has a higher protein content, ranging from 12% to 14%, which makes it ideal for producing chewy, crusty bread. On the other hand, all-purpose flour has a lower protein content, usually between 10% and 12%, making it suitable for a wide range of baked goods, from cakes and cookies to pastry dough.

Characteristics of Bread Flour

Bread flour is characterized by its high protein content, which is achieved through a process of selective breeding and milling. The high protein content in bread flour produces a stronger gluten network, resulting in a more chewy and elastic crumb. Bread flour is ideal for producing bread that requires a lot of structure and chew, such as artisan bread, sourdough, and baguettes. However, its high protein content can make it more challenging to work with, especially for beginners.

Characteristics of All-Purpose Flour

All-purpose flour, as the name suggests, is a versatile flour that can be used for a wide range of baked goods. Its lower protein content makes it easier to work with, and it produces a more tender crumb. All-purpose flour is a good choice for baked goods that require a delicate texture, such as cakes, cookies, and pastry dough. However, its lower protein content can result in a less chewy and less crusty bread.

What is the main difference between bread flour and all-purpose flour?

Bread flour and all-purpose flour are two types of wheat flours that have distinct differences in terms of their protein content, texture, and usage in baking. Bread flour, also known as strong flour, has a higher protein content (12-14%) compared to all-purpose flour (10-12%). This higher protein content gives bread flour its characteristic chewy texture and makes it ideal for producing bread that requires a lot of rise and structure, such as baguettes, ciabatta, and pizza dough.

The higher protein content in bread flour also means that it can absorb more liquid and produce a more extensible dough, which is essential for creating the complex networks of gluten strands that give bread its crumb and texture. In contrast, all-purpose flour has a lower protein content and is more versatile, making it suitable for a wide range of baked goods, including cakes, cookies, and pastries. Can I use all-purpose flour to make bread, and if so, how?

Yes, you can use all-purpose flour to make bread, but you may need to make some adjustments to the recipe to achieve the desired results. All-purpose flour has a lower protein content than bread flour, which can affect the rise and texture of the bread. To make bread with all-purpose flour, you can try adding more yeast or leavening agents to help the bread rise, or you can add some vital wheat gluten to increase the protein content. You can also try using a combination of all-purpose flour and other ingredients, such as whole wheat flour or rye flour, to create a more complex flavor and texture.

When using all-purpose flour to make bread, it is essential to keep in mind that the bread may not have the same chewy texture and crust as bread made with bread flour. However, with some experimentation and adjustments, you can still produce a delicious and satisfying loaf. Some tips for making bread with all-purpose flour include using a longer rising time, adding more yeast or leavening agents, and using a higher hydration level to help the dough develop. How do I store all-purpose flour to maintain its quality and freshness?

To maintain the quality and freshness of all-purpose flour, it is essential to store it properly. All-purpose flour should be stored in an airtight container, such as a glass or plastic bin, to protect it from moisture, light, and pests. The container should be kept in a cool, dry place, such as a pantry or cupboard, away from direct sunlight and heat sources. It is also a good idea to label the container with the date and contents, so you can easily keep track of how long you have had the flour and ensure that you use the oldest flour first.

Proper storage can help to preserve the flavor, texture, and nutritional value of all-purpose flour. Whole grain flours, in particular, are more prone to spoilage due to their higher oil content, so it is essential to store them in the refrigerator or freezer to prevent rancidity. When storing all-purpose flour, it is also a good idea to check it regularly for signs of spoilage, such as an off smell or taste, and to use it within a few months of opening.
